The concept of convergent species represents one of Scarlet & Violet’s most innovative mechanics, introducing creatures like Wiglett and Toedscool that mimic familiar Pokemon while constituting entirely separate evolutionary lines with distinct characteristics and origins.
With The Teal Mask expansion, trainers encounter Poltchageist as the latest convergent species, drawing inspiration from matcha tea traditions while serving as a distinct counterpart to the Galar region’s Polteageist. This creative approach expands the Pokemon universe while maintaining nostalgic connections.
As a dual Grass/Ghost-type Pokemon, Poltchageist possesses intriguing lore suggesting it utilizes its distinctive green powder to absorb life energy from unsuspecting humans. Where to Find Poltchageist: Exact Spawn Locations and Strategies
Trainers will find Poltchageist exclusively inhabiting bamboo forest environments situated along Kitakami’s eastern territories, making Reveller’s Road and the areas north of Mossfell Confluence your primary hunting destinations.
While Reveller’s Road occasionally yields sightings, our field testing confirmed significantly better results in the compact bamboo patch directly north of Mossfell Confluence, where we encountered a luminous Tera Poltchageist. This location deserves your focused attention.
Poltchageist represents a relatively uncommon spawn within its habitat zones. If initial searches prove unsuccessful, implement area reset strategies by traveling to distant locations before returning. Its diminutive size makes thorough visual scanning essential—move methodically through bamboo clusters.
Advanced hunting technique: Utilize a Pokemon with the Compound Eyes ability at the front of your party (even if fainted) to increase the chance of encountering Pokemon holding items. This can help when farming for Artisan forms.
Contrary to typical Ghost-type behavior patterns, Poltchageist appears consistently throughout all daylight cycles rather than restricting itself to nocturnal hours. This flexibility simplifies hunting schedules for trainers with limited playtime availability.

Poltchageist Forms: Counterfeit vs Artisan Differences
Understanding Poltchageist’s dual-form system proves crucial for successful evolution planning. The game features two distinct variations: the frequently encountered Counterfeit Poltchageist and the substantially rarer Artisan Poltchageist.
Field data indicates approximately 85% of wild Poltchageist encounters will be Counterfeit form, while only 15% represent the coveted Artisan variant. This rarity makes Artisan forms particularly valuable for completionists and competitive battlers.
Form identification requires releasing your captured Poltchageist from its Poke Ball and carefully rotating your camera perspective to examine its base section. The presence of a small square authentication stamp confirms you’ve obtained an Artisan Poltchageist—Counterfeit specimens lack this distinctive marking.
The game interface provides immediate form confirmation during the post-capture sequence, but this information becomes inaccessible afterward. We strongly recommend documenting your findings since the game offers no subsequent method to verify forms through Pokedex or status screens.
Pro tip: Nicknaming your Poltchageist immediately after capture with identifiers like “Artisan” or “Counterfeit” prevents future confusion, especially when managing multiple specimens for evolution or breeding purposes.
Evolving Poltchageist into Sinistcha: Item Locations and Evolution Steps
The evolution process transforming Poltchageist into Sinistcha demands careful preparation, requiring trainers to obtain form-specific evolution items before initiation. This differs significantly from standard level-based evolution mechanics.
Counterfeit Poltchageist evolution necessitates acquiring an Unremarkable Teacup, located within a cavern adjacent to the Paradise Barrens fast travel point. This easily accessible location requires minimal navigation from the teleportation marker.
Artisan Poltchageist evolution demands a Masterpiece Teacup, discovered in a subterranean chamber at Timeless Woods’ deepest section. This remote location necessitates thorough exploration of the wooded area’s lower regions.
Once you possess the appropriate teacup for your Poltchageist’s form, navigate to your Bag’s items section, select the teacup, and choose the ‘Use’ command targeting your Poltchageist. This triggers immediate evolution into Sinistcha without additional requirements.
Critical warning: Avoid selecting the ‘Give’ option when interacting with the teacup, as this mistakenly treats it as a hold item rather than an evolution catalyst. This common error prevents evolution and wastes valuable items—always verify you’re using the ‘Use’ function.
Evolution outcome varies by form: Counterfeit Poltchageist becomes Unremarkable Form Sinistcha with balanced stats, while Artisan Poltchageist evolves into Masterpiece Form Sinistcha featuring enhanced Special Attack and unique move combinations.
